Market Overview
The global fiber capacitor market was valued at USD 1.92 billion in 2024 and is projected to reach USD 3.38 billion by 2035, growing at a CAGR of 5.2% during the forecast period. Growth is primarily driven by the rising adoption of fiber capacitors in high-frequency circuits, advanced energy storage systems, and precision instrumentation. The market benefits from continuous R&D in dielectric materials, fiber winding technology, and thermal management solutions, which enhance capacitor performance and reliability.

Market Segmentation
The fiber capacitor market is segmented based on type, material, application, and distribution channel. Types include film capacitors, ceramic fiber capacitors, and electrolytic fiber capacitors. Material segmentation covers polypropylene, polyester, and other high-performance polymers. Applications range across telecommunications, industrial equipment, automotive, aerospace, and defense. Among these, film-type fiber capacitors lead the market due to their high reliability, low loss, and superior performance in high-frequency circuits.

Competitive Landscape
Key market players include Murata Manufacturing Co., Ltd., TDK Corporation, KEMET Corporation, Vishay Intertechnology, Inc., and AVX Corporation. These companies emphasize strategic partnerships, mergers and acquisitions, and continuous R&D investment to strengthen their market position.
